About THE CENTRIS
THE CENTRIS is a condominium in Singapore District 22, completed in 2009 with 99 yrs lease commencing from 2006. It recorded 20 transactions during the latest 12-month period in the database, with a median transacted price of $2.05M and a median of $1,653 psf. The most frequently transacted size range is 1,201–1,500 sqft, representing 50.0% of transactions with recorded floor area. BOON LAY MRT STATION is approximately 120 m away by straight-line distance. 4 primary schools are located within a 1 km straight-line radius.
